Vietnamese Beef and Lemongrass Skewers
One of my favorite cooks, Jackie M, posted this recipe recently on Google+.
And as expected, this turned out to be an easy dish but with incredible taste. You don't have to use Lemongrass skewers, but it's a nice touch (and less cleaning afterwards),
PS: Lemongrass, Hoisin and Sriracha are essential to this dish though!!
Steps
- 1
Combine and mix all ingredients- except, oil Hoisin and Sriracha - well and let it rest for 20 minutes
- 2
Divide into 12 portions. Mould into sausage shapes wrapped around lemongrass stems (or regular skewers).
- 3
Brush with oil, then grill on medium heat for 6 minutes
- 4
Remove from lemongrass stems and place 2 pieces on baguette
- 5
Drizzle with hoisin and chilli sauce, and serve.
